POLICE have seized a sign from a traffic light beggar who "is not homeless."

Officers spotted the man at a traffic light junction in BD3 on Sunday morning.

The beggar was also wanted on a warrant.

A police spokesperson said: "He has been arrested and will be attending court."

The sign read: "Homeless. Please help. Change or food. God bless you. Thanks."

This comes just over a week after a man posing as homeless was caught begging in Bowling and Barkerend for the second time.
